I would only consider using a counterpoise/faraday cage. They are not hard and will not stuff up ubiquitous computers. Here is my Physics Dept one for use as an indoors demo. It costs little and nearly guarantees safety and low radiation. Use heavy gauge wide animal fencing mesh which forms a natural roll. I strongly recommend not trying to run without one indoors unless you are happy to pay for anything you blow up.

Hi John,

If you are operating outside and the NST is under the primary (or
very close to it), I would ground the NST to RF ground (a copper rod
staked in the ground).  The strike ring will be tied to the base of
the secondary. The base of the secondary will be connected to RF
ground.  Safety of the NST chassis during operation is not as much an
issue if located there as no one should be close to the NST while
operating.  Any secondary strike to the strike ring will return
directly to the base of the coil.  Any stike to the primary will arc
to the safety gap and go to the NST chassis and then return to the
base of the coil via RF ground.  Any overvoltage of the primary
circuit will also be shunted via the safety gap to the NST chassis
where it wants to go.  This grounding will help keep voltage
transients off of the mains ground and out of the house where it can
do damage to equipment.  The mains ground can be used to ground the
variac and line filter, but should stop there and not go the the NST.

BTW, grounding the center terminal of the safety gap directly to the
NST chassis is correct as it is intended to protect the NST.
